Transaction 07a5709f36c1dd9cec77939e85abb0e7f2ad7a585e100ec918c3cf41f51e73fc
1 Input
1 Output
-
07a5709f36c1dd9cec77939e85abb0e7f2ad7a585e100ec918c3cf41f51e73fc:0
- value
- 680431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2586da26eb584c54345ba0989bc11be220585e4 OP_EQUAL
- address
- 3LsDkvyJ77hEt73nfG1n68XaXdmYwyi4Tk